Spring 컨테이너란?
주입을 이용하여 객체를 관리하는 컨테이너이다. 컨테이너의 사전적 의미는 무언가를 담는 용기, 즉 그릇을 의미한다. 이를 통해 접급하자면 컨테이너는 객체관리를 주로 수행하는 그릇정도로 이해할 수 있다. 빈의 생성과 관계, 사용, 생명 주기등을 관장한다. 컨테이너를 통해 시스템 전반에서 언제는 사용가능하다.
주요용어
-
POJO
- 어플리케이션의 핵심 코드를 담고 있는 클래스
- Plain Old Java Object, 직역하면 오래된 방식의 자바 객체라는 뜻으로 특정 환경에 종속없는 단순 클래스이다. 종속되지 않는 다는 것은 코드를 간결히 할 수 있고, 객체지향 설계를 충실히 이행하고 있음을 보여준다.
-
Bean
- 스프링 컨테이너가 생성하고 관리하는 어플리케이션 객체
'JAVA' 카테고리의 다른 글
Mybatis (0) | 2021.01.13 |
---|---|
Security (0) | 2021.01.12 |
JAVA 스터디 : JDBC 간단 설명 (0) | 2021.01.08 |
JAVA 스터디 : form 데이터 주고 받기 (0) | 2021.01.04 |
JAVA 스터디 : Request Mapping (0) | 2021.01.01 |